Scan barcode
612 pages • first pub 2015 (editions)
ISBN/UID: 9781988479798
Format: Hardcover
Language: English
Publisher: Deborah A. Cooke
Publication date: 26 June 2018
612 pages • first pub 2015 (editions)
ISBN/UID: 9781988479798
Format: Hardcover
Language: English
Publisher: Deborah A. Cooke
Publication date: 26 June 2018
610 pages • first pub 2015 (editions)
ISBN/UID: 9781927477489
Format: Digital
Language: English
Publisher: Deborah A. Cooke
Publication date: 31 October 2014
610 pages • first pub 2015 (editions)
ISBN/UID: 9781927477489
Format: Digital
Language: English
Publisher: Deborah A. Cooke
Publication date: 31 October 2014
618 pages • first pub 2015 (editions)
ISBN/UID: 9781927477496
Format: Paperback
Language: English
Publisher: Not specified
Publication date: Not specified
618 pages • first pub 2015 (editions)
ISBN/UID: 9781927477496
Format: Paperback
Language: English
Publisher: Not specified
Publication date: Not specified
612 pages • first pub 2015 (editions)
ISBN/UID: 9781927477724
Format: Paperback
Language: English
Publisher: Deborah A. Cooke
Publication date: 10 July 2015
612 pages • first pub 2015 (editions)
ISBN/UID: 9781927477724
Format: Paperback
Language: English
Publisher: Deborah A. Cooke
Publication date: 10 July 2015